Dr Austin Houldsworth is a double graduate of the Royal College of Art and fellow of the Royal Society of Arts. He describes himself as an interdisciplinary design practitioner, researcher and educator with a focus on critical and speculative design practice.
He is a Product Design lecturer at Huddersfield University, associate lecturer at Sheffield Hallam University, visiting lecturer at University of Chester and the Royal College of Art.
He built the world's first prototype human fossilisation machine and recently founded the Intergalactic Space Agency at the Eden Project.
In his spare time (god knows where he finds it...) Houldsworth runs Ahaaa- a design consultancy that works with industry to develop and run design competitions such as the 'Creative Insight Awards' for Worldpay.
